National Migrant Education Program: Oral Language Skills--English (Destrezas de Lenguage Oral--Espanol).
Used as an integral part of the migrant student skills system operated by the Migrant Student Record Transfer System (MSRTS), the oral language skills list contains a catalog of skills typical of the K-12 grade range. This catalog includes a sample of the MSRTS transmittal record which permits teachers to report the skills being worked on at the time of a student's withdrawal. Published in English and Spanish, the document defines terminology used for the MSRTS oral language skills list: areas, topics, subtopics, and skills. It includes directions for recording oral language development in listening and speaking in the following areas: (1) listening comprehension, which covers the topics of oral directions, recall, and relationships; (2) critical listening, which presents evaluation as a topic; (3) personal listening, which includes the topic of self-selected creative listening; (4) oral expression, which covers the topics of functional communication and creative communication; and (5) vocabulary development, which includes basic vocabulary and expanded vocabulary topics. The list also includes suggested uses of MSRTS Oral Language Records for teachers wishing to develop a child's oral language program. (JD)
